The Role: We are looking for an exceptional Senior TPM to help build a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) solution for Global Private Brands. Product development in Private Brands is a complex and global process. Some of the steps involved in getting a product from inception to the customer include Product design Quality certification Third-party and in-house testing Mass production Finalizing product label and packing FDA approval (if ingestible) etc. Finally since this is a WW platform the unique international requirements add another layer of complexity. These different workflows involve complex sub-tasks and interactions with different retail systems making this a truly complex and challenging capability with deep tentacles across many systems. The goal of this platform is to improve speed drastically reduce the time to market and enhance productivity across the entire product development process.
